jellyfin / jellyfin-androidtv

Android TV Client for Jellyfin
https://jellyfin.org
GNU General Public License v2.0
2.85k stars 488 forks source link

Jellyfin 0.15.3 still appears leaving an item puts the "cursor" back to the first item of the library #2414

Closed Soizzer closed 1 year ago

Soizzer commented 1 year ago

Describe the bug

Jellyfin 0.15.3 still has unresolved bugs (#2363),steps to reproduce:

1、Play the video for a few seconds, Jellyfin it will appear:

2、Enter a library (TV, Movies and Playlists all seem to be affected); 3、Select any item that is not the first and click it to open the detailed view with the summary and seasons; 4、Click the back button on the remote, the cursor will not be over current item anymore, but over the first item.

Logs

No response

Application version

0.15.3 / 0.15.2

Where did you install the app from?

Sideloaded APK

Device information

Tmall MagicBox_M16S

Android version

YUN OS TV

Jellyfin server version

10.8.8

nielsvanvelzen commented 1 year ago

I can't reproduce this issue after it was fixed with #2395 in 0.15.2. Can you share some more information?

Soizzer commented 1 year ago

I can't reproduce this issue after it was fixed with #2395 in 0.15.2. Can you share some more information?

  • How many items are in the library?
  • Which item index is selected (the number before the total count)
  • What image size & type is used?
  • What grid direction is used?
  • Which sorting is used?
  • Are the watched/favorite filter enabled?

After starting jellyfin for the first time, everything works fine, but after playing a few video files, exiting jellyfin and restarting, I have this bug again.

The same bug occurs after uninstalling and reinstalling.

  1. Less than 200 items in the library;
  2. Any item except the first item;
  3. Any image size is the same, poster type;
  4. Horizontal grid;
  5. Sort by adding time;
  6. Not using watched/favorite filter.

If the bug still does not reproduce, please try to play a few video files, then exit Jellyfin, restart Jellyfin and test again.

I have reproduced the bug on another TV.

Schwalch commented 1 year ago

I also still have the problem that the cursor jumps back to the first item.

Device: Sony KD-55XH9005 Android version: 10 (Kernel 4.19.75) Jellyfin client: 0.15.2 & 0.15.3 (Bug still present) Jellyfin server: 10.8.8

I have created several libraries with different numbers of items, but it did not work. The bug comes as soon as you play a video for the first time. As long as you don't play a video and just click on the items and go back to the items overview without playing the item, it works.

Workflow without the bug:
Items overview -> Click on item -> Back to the items overview [Cursor is still on the correct item]

Workflow with bug:
Items overview -> Click on item -> Start video -> Back to the item view -> Back to the items overview [Cursor is on the first item]

NeobinX commented 1 year ago

I also encounter it. Exactly as @Schwalch has already described.

Device: Sony TV OS: AndroidTV 9 Kernel: 4.9.125 Jellyfin server: 10.8.9 (10.8.8 was the same) Jellyfin app: 0.15.2 (from Google Play Store)

Starting point: Jellyfin app force exited

From now on, even if you only select an item, but do not play it and go back (where it worked before), the cursor jumps ever to the first item. Exiting the app does not change this behavior for me. Only if I force exit it via the AndroidTV apps menu and start it afterwards again, then it works (cursor on correct position) as long as I do not play an item again.

silentTeee commented 1 year ago

So I was having the same issue on my Hisense HiSmartTV A4, but it looks like I was able to get it to stop by force stopping the app and clearing the app data.

Once I did that, I couldn't reproduce the issue in any of the Genre, Artist, or Album views, so it might be worth trying this.

NeobinX commented 1 year ago

So I was having the same issue on my Hisense HiSmartTV A4, but it looks like I was able to get it to stop by force stopping the app and clearing the app data.

Once I did that, I couldn't reproduce the issue in any of the Genre, Artist, or Album views, so it might be worth trying this.

Thanks, but unfortunately this did not work for me.

A really annoying issue and it seems to not even be reproducible and/or traceable by the maintainers?

wolfiiy commented 1 year ago

Exact same behavior as https://github.com/jellyfin/jellyfin-androidtv/issues/2363 on version 0.15.5 (fresh install), Play Store, Shield TV Pro 2019, Android 11, JF 10.8.9. Clearing the cache fixes the issue until any piece of media is played, then the issue persists.

How many items are in the library? 232, 104, 5, 8 Which item index is selected (the number before the total count)? any What image size & type is used? medium posters What grid direction is used? horizontal Which sorting is used? alphabetical Are the watched/favorite filter enabled? no

alex3305 commented 1 year ago

I have encountered this bug on every release of 0.15.x of Jellyfin Android. Just tested this on 0.15.6. Downgrading to 0.14.x fixes the issue. I'm using an Nvidia Shield and even with a factory reset of the device and Jellyfin with stock settings.

Application version

Any 0.15.x release

Where did you install the app from?

Play Store or sideloaded APK (for older versions)

Device information

Nvidia Shield Pro 2019

Android version

Android TV 8 / Nvidia Shield EXPERIENCE 8.2.3

Jellyfin server version

10.8.8

vortex91 commented 1 year ago

Not sure if this is just me but the issue seems to resolve itself when changing view to vertical instead of horizontal. Going back to horizantal the issue comes back. v15.10

nielsvanvelzen commented 1 year ago

Thanks for all the additional information everyone, I've found the culprit and it will be fixed in the upcoming 0.15.11 release.

McClane1988 commented 1 year ago

i updated to the latest android tv version, cleared my cache and tried different libraries and this bug still happens for me. any suggestions?